Description de Cours HPE Technologies OpenStack et Cloud/NFV - Fondation Référence de cours Education Services : H0MD5S Durée du cours – 5 jours Mode de réalisation : Cours en présentiel Inscription : HPE Education Services 01.73.43.02.58 Ce cours événementiel de 5 jours apporte aux participants les connaissances pour comprendre les concepts et utiliser un environnement OpenStack® opérationnel, manipuler les objets (Identités, réseaux, machines virtuelles) et comprendre l’écosystème (outils, plate-forme de développement,..). ,..). Ce cours fournit une base pour accéder à la formation Fundamentals of OpenStack® technology (H6C68S) et à des formations avancées sur Neutron, Ceph, Swift, etc Il est réalisé dans les locaux de HPE Grenoble au sein de l’entité de développement et de conseil Cloud / OpenStack® / HPE Helion et il sera co-animé par Jérôme ARMAND formateur spécialiste dans le domaine du Cloud et d’OpenStack® et par des consultants HPE EMEA, spécialistes de chacun des domaines. Les Travaux Pratiques seront réalisés sur les labs du Solution Innovation Center de Grenoble. Les intervenants Contrairement aux cours standards délivrés par HPE Education Services, ce cours n’est pas animé par un seul intervenant, mais plusieurs experts Hewlett Packard Enterprise de l’équipe : EMEA Cloud Center of Expertise basée à Grenoble interviendront sur les sujets spécifiques de leur domaine d’expertise. Objectifs du Cours Comme la technologie OpenStack® est au cœur de la stratégie Cloud et NFV d’HP, l’objectif de cette formation est de fournir un premier niveau de connaissances techniques en combinant des présentations magistrales et des sessions de travaux dirigés. Elle couvre OpenStack, ses composants et son écosystème, le rôle d’HPE dans la communauté open-source OpenStack, les produits/services d’HPE basés sur OpenStack, les serveurs/systèmes de stockage/équipements réseaux nécessaires pour déployer OpenStack, et enfin NFV. Elle prépare les participants soit à utiliser directement ces connaissances, soit à accéder à des formations avancées. Les services de formation HP sont soumis aux conditions générales relatives aux services de formation HP. c05293958 - H0MD5S, Créée en Septembre 2016 Descriptif de Cours Audience Cette formation est proposée aux employés d’HP et d’autres compagnies ayant une formation technique (consultants, architectes, chefs de projets) et une motivation forte pour développer leurs connaissances sur la technologie OpenStack et les outils associés, sur le cloud et NFV, afin de soutenir des activités d’avant-vente, de déploiement de solutions ou de test/support Prérequis Les participants doivent être à l’aise avec les bases de l’administration système sous Linux. Chaque étudiant apportera son PC pour les sessions de travaux dirigés. A l’issue de ce cours Ce cours fournit une base pour accéder à la formation « Fundamentals of OpenStack® technology (H6C68S) » et aux formations avancées sur Neutron, Ceph, Swift, etc : H4S71S Networking in OpenStack® using Neutron H8Q17S Neutron Troubleshooting and Tuning H4S72S Object Storage in OpenStack® using Swift H4S73S Block Storage in OpenStack® using Cinder H8Q16S Ceph for OpenStack® Agenda Détaillé du Cours Jour 1 : - - - - - Introduction au Cloud o Définitions, Cloud public, Cloud Managed, Cloud privé, Cloud Hybride, Iaas, Paas, Saas o Revue du marché o Portefeuille HP et stratégie Démonstrations o Depuis un portail CSA Créations de machines virtuelles dans différents Clouds publics Créations de machines virtuelles dans différents Clouds privés Références HP dans le Cloud, et en France Concurrence à OpenStack o En interne HP o En externe Composants d’OpenStack Démonstration basée sur le portail Horizon o Création d’un identifiant o Création d’un VLAN o Création d’une VM Présentation de NFV o Qu’est-ce qu’NFV o Les cas d’utilisation définis par l’ETSI o L’architecture de référence, les interfaces o L’organisation de l’ETSI NFV, les Workgroups o NFV et OpenStack o Opensource NFV OPNFV, Arno o HP OpenNFV o L’orchestrateur HP NFV Director NFV et OpenStack Carrier Grade o L’apport de WindRiver o Architectures Multi-domaines, multi-DC Jour 2 - - Le matériel pour les solutions cloud o Les serveurs o Les baies de stockage (3PAR) et les clusters de stockage virtuel (VSA) o (Les équipements réseau sont abordés en détail plus tard) Zoom sur les composants OpenStack pour le stockage o Stockage Block et Cinder o Stockage Object et Swift, Ceph et Scality Lab (travaux dirigés) « découverte d’OpenStack » © Copyright 2016 Hewlett Packard Enterprise Development LP. Les informations continues dans ce document sont modifiables sans préavis. c05293958 - Septembre 2016 Descriptif de Cours o o o o o o o o o o o o Accès ssh à la stack de management, undercloud, overcloud Accès et utilisation du tableau de bord Horizon Surveillance avec Icinga, Kibana Création d’une identité d’utilisateur et d’un tenant Keystone Création d’un réseau privé et d’un sous réseau Définition des paramètres de sécurité Création d’une machine virtuelle Nova/Glance Création d’un gateway et d’une adresse IP flottante Neutron Utilisation de Heat et de l’orchestration OpenStack metadata API Création d’un volume, attachement au serveur Nettoyage Jour 3 : - - Lab Devstack o Construire un cloud sur OpenStack “in a box” avec tous les contrôleurs sur une machine o Outil devstack et son opération Equipements Réseau, Portefeuille HP d’équipement réseau Les architectures et les technologies réseau dans OpenStack o Bridge, dnsmask, bonding, VLAN trunking o IPTables, Namespaces, Load balancing LVS, HA proxy Nova networking Neutron networking o Linux Bridge et Open vSwitch (OVS) o Neutron routing, load balancing, sécurité Lab Réseau o Focalisation sur les fonctions réseau d’OpenStack o au travers de différents use-cases, suivi de la vie d’un paquet et des différents composants (Bridges, routers, tables de filtrage), switching, routage et virtualisation Jour 4 : - - - - - FLOSS et Linux o Définition, exemples, types de licences o Histoire de Linux o Projet GNU o Qu’est-ce que Linux, les distributions et leurs relations o Participation d’HP dans l’Open Source o Liens entre version de Linux et roadmap Intel o Distributions commerciales : RHEL, Suse, Ubuntu Git o Qu’est-ce que Git o Gestion des « repositories » et des branches o Commit o Rebasing o Outil GitLab Ansible o Architecture et modèle de fonctionnement o Inventory, playbook, play, task o When, loop o Ansible Vault o Exemples d’utilisations, démos Python o Qu’est-ce que Python, Histoire de Python, importance de python o Principales commandes, exemples de code o Python Package Index, novaclient API o Références Développement d’applications sur OpenStack et « Dev Platform » o Différence entre applications traditionnelles et applications « Cloud native » o Développer avec la « Dev Platform » o Administration de la « Dev Platform » o Plugins disponibles pour la « Dev Platform » Jour 5 : © Copyright 2016 Hewlett Packard Enterprise Development LP. Les informations continues dans ce document sont modifiables sans préavis. c05293958 - Septembre 2016 Descriptif de Cours - - - Configuration matérielles pour déployer OpenStack o Configurations complètes serveurs, stockage, réseau o Détails des éléments (Bill of Material) o Dimensionnement Retour d’expérience d’installations d’OpenStack chez des clients Lab « Object Storage » Ceph Docker o Qu’est-ce qu’un « container » ? o Histoire des containers o L’écosystème Docker o HP et Docker o Démonstration Lab Docker Questions/Réponses Synthèse © Copyright 2016 Hewlett Packard Enterprise Development LP. Les informations continues dans ce document sont modifiables sans préavis. c05293958 - Septembre 2016